  • Page 6 4. Depth Knob Controls the depth of the chorus effect. Turn this knob clockwise to increase the depth for a thick chorus sound, and counter-clockwise to decrease the depth for a shallow, light chorus sound. 5.Voice Knob Controls the number of chorus voices used. At the knob’s minimum position, only a single chorus voice is present.

  • Page 8 Connections The Multi Chorus has a single input and a pair of outputs. Out 1 is used if the Multi Chorus is being connected to only one amplifier. Out 2 is used for stereo operation. Connect Out 1 to the first amplifier and Out 2 to the second amplifier.
  • Page 10: Battery Replacement

    Battery Replacement 1. Using the tip of a 1/4” guitar cable, push one of the release pins in on either side of the pedal, and remove the pedal from the pedal chassis. 2. Remove the battery from the battery compartment and disconnect the battery cable.
